  • the present invention relates to films for coating molded part blanks, a method for producing these films and the use of the films in automobile construction.
  • EP-A-374 551 discloses coated substrates which are suitable for the production of add-on parts for automobile bodies.
  • the coated substrates described in EP-A-374 551 consist of metal sheets which are coated with at least one layer of paint or of composite materials, the surface layer of which consists of the coated metal sheets.
  • P4424290.9 discloses substrates coated with several layers. These are deformed and, if necessary, further processed with the aid of further materials. In this way, add-on parts for vehicle bodies can be produced.
  • the object of the present invention was to provide films for coating molded part blanks which, after the molded molded part blanks have been deformed, have improved properties compared to the coated substrates disclosed in EP-A-374 551 and only small amounts of solvents are emitted during their production and simple quality monitoring is possible.
  • foils which are characterized in that A. the films made of a pigmented plastic carrier film with a thickness of 10 to 500 ⁇ m,
  • the plastic film or the effect layer is coated with a transparent plastic film or a transparent lacquer layer, which may be provided with effect pigments.
  • a peelable film is applied to the non-coated side of the carrier film, the transparent plastic film or the clear lacquer layer.
  • the present invention also relates to a method for producing a film coated with a plurality of layers, in which the surface of a pigmented plastic film with a thickness of 10 to 500 ⁇ m is coated with a transparent plastic film or transparent lacquer layer, optionally before the transparent film or is applied An additional effect layer is applied to the lacquer layer, and the lacquer layer or the lacquer layers applied to the surface of the pigmented plastic film are cured.
  • a peelable film is applied to the non-coated side of the carrier film and / or the transparent plastic film or transparent lacquer layer.
  • Another object of the present invention is the use of the films according to the invention for coating molded part blanks for the production of automobile bodies and for the production of attachments for vehicle bodies. Therefore, according to the invention, suitable paints are preferably used for automobile bodies, which, however, must have the flexibility required for the purposes of the invention.
  • the pigmented film can first be laminated onto the non-deformed substrate, for example a metal sheet, and then deformed. This is how the effect layer is applied if necessary. Finally, the coating is carried out with the transparent lacquer or the transparent film.
  • the bodies coated with the films according to the invention are distinguished by a very high resistance to stone chips and corrosion. Further advantages of the coated films according to the invention consist in the fact that they can be produced in systems with a small space requirement, that only very small amounts of organic solvents are emitted in the manufacture of the coated bodies according to the invention by the use of the plastic films, and that the quality monitoring is carried out during manufacture the plastic film can use. On the other hand, in conventional painting of metal sheets, the quality of the coating can only be assessed after application of the paint layers to the substrate, so that in the event of quality defects, the painted substrate as a whole must be discarded.
  • Thermoplastic materials are predominantly used for producing the films according to the invention.
  • the carrier film can consist of a polyolefin, a polyamide, a polyurethane, a polyester, a polyacrylate, a polycarbonate or a mixture of different polymeric substances, have a thickness of 10-500, preferably 20-250 ⁇ m and contains dyes and / or pigments .
  • an effect layer may be applied to the surface of the pigmented plastic film before the transparent film or transparent lacquer layer is applied.
  • This can be another very low pigment film or a layer of lacquer.
  • the same materials are considered for the former as for the carrier film.
  • the Clear coat or transparent film containing the effect pigments so that they take over the function of the effect layer.
  • topcoat or basecoat suitable for the conventional painting of automobile bodies can be used as the coating layer, provided the flexibility and pigmentation required for the purposes of the invention are present.
  • They essentially contain a polymeric binder, possibly a crosslinking agent and coating aid.
  • the topcoat or basecoat used can contain, for example, a polyester resin, a polyurethane resin, an epoxy resin or a polyacrylate resin or a mixture of such binders.
  • the topcoat or basecoat may contain an aminoplast resin, a polyisocyanate resin, a carboxyl group-containing crosslinking agent or a mixture of such crosslinking agents.
  • paint auxiliaries include into consideration: anti-foam, anti-settling, flow and rheology aids such as Viscalex HV30 from Allied Colloid Ltd. or a layered silicate (Laponite RD from the company. Laporte).
  • Effect pigments are e.g. Pearlescent pigment from Merck, metal paint, etc.
  • the solids ratio of pigment to binder is ⁇ 0.01: 1, preferably ⁇ _0.006: 1, particularly preferably ⁇ 0.003: 1.
  • a transparent lacquer layer is applied to the surface of the pigmented or colored plastic film or to the effect layer described. All transparent lacquers that can be used for conventional automotive painting can be used here. Powder clearcoats can also be used. These transparent lacquers also consist of a binder, a crosslinking agent and other common additives.
  • the layers of paint are usually cured by heating to temperatures of 60 to 230 ° C. There is a reaction between the binders and crosslinking agents contained in the paints, and three-dimensional polymer networks are formed which give the paint surface a particularly high resistance to mechanical or chemical attacks.
  • the lacquer layers can be applied, for example, by spraying, rolling or knife coating.
  • the films according to the invention described can be rolled up.
  • the products can therefore be offered and delivered in the form of rolls.
  • the varnishes that may be used must therefore have sufficient flexibility for this.
  • the foils can be applied to all molded parts that are used to manufacture vehicle bodies, attachments for vehicle bodies, household appliances, e.g. Refrigerators, washing machines and dishwashers are suitable to be applied.
  • the foils are mainly applied to pretreated metal sheets. These can be pretreated, for example, by phosphating and / or chromating.
  • a transparent plastic film can be applied to the pigmented film or the effect layer.
  • all materials can be used here that are also suitable for the carrier film.
  • the possibly coated plastic films described can be laminated to the surface of a molded part blank, preferably made of sheet metal.
  • either the sheet can be coated successively with a carrier film, if necessary an effect layer and a transparent plastic film or a transparent lacquer layer. From this sheet coated in this way, which as Rolls can be stored and delivered, automotive parts are cut and shaped.
  • the pigmented carrier film is first coated one after the other, if necessary with an effect layer and with a transparent lacquer or a transparent plastic film.
  • This layered structure is laminated onto the sheets from which automobile parts are produced by cutting and shaping. The requirements for the flexibility of the paints used must therefore also be based on the application process described.

  • Adhesion to the surface to be coated can be achieved in different ways.
  • One possibility is, for example, that foils containing adhesion-promoting groups, e.g. Have urethane groups, acid anhydride groups or carboxyl groups or films which have been provided with adhesion-promoting groups by coextrusion with a polymer having adhesion-promoting groups.
  • the adhesion between the film and the surface to be coated can also be achieved by using an adhesive.
  • Adhesives that are solid at room temperature and liquid at room temperature can be used.
  • the substrate When laminating foils with adhesion-promoting groups, the substrate is generally covered with the foil in such a way that the adhesion promoter layer touches the substrate surface.
  • Pressure and heat are then laminated onto the surface to be coated. Pressure and temperature are to be chosen so that a firm connection is created between the substrate and the film.
  • the procedure is similar when using adhesives that are solid at room temperature. If liquid adhesives are used, the procedure is generally that the liquid adhesive is applied to the substrate and the coated plastic film is laminated onto the heated substrate coated with the adhesive.

Abstract

La présente invention concerne des films utilisés pour revêtir des ébauches de pièces façonnées, caractérisés par le fait que la surface d'un film porteur en plastique pigmenté, d'une épaisseur de 10-500 νm, éventuellement pourvue d'une couche à effet, est recouverte éventuellement une couche de laque transparente ou d'un film de plastique transparent.
